Is Dental Treatment expensive in Iceland?

Overall, dental treatment in Iceland tends to be relatively expensive compared to some other countries. This is mainly due to the high cost of living and operating expenses in Iceland, which can influence healthcare costs, including dental care.

It’s important to note that dental care in Iceland is not covered by the country’s national health insurance system unlike the NHS in the UK. Therefore, individuals are responsible for paying for their dental treatment out of pocket or through private dental insurance if they have it. This lack of coverage can contribute to the higher costs.

Why is Dental Treatment so expensive in Iceland?

Several factors contribute to the relatively high cost of dental treatment in Iceland. Here are some possible reasons:

  1. High cost of living: Iceland has one of the highest costs of living in the world, which affects various aspects of daily life, including healthcare. Dentists and dental clinics have to cover their overhead expenses, such as rent, utilities, equipment, and staff salaries, which can be significant in an expensive country like Iceland.
  2. Limited competition: Iceland has a relatively small population, and the number of dental clinics and dentists might be limited compared to more densely populated countries. Limited competition can contribute to higher prices since there is less pressure to offer lower prices in a market with fewer alternatives.
  3. Technological advancements: Dental clinics often invest in advanced technologies and equipment to provide high-quality dental care. These investments come at a cost, which can be reflected in the prices of dental treatments. Iceland’s commitment to maintaining advanced healthcare infrastructure may contribute to higher treatment costs.
  4. Education and expertise: Becoming a dentist requires extensive education and training. The cost of dental education and the expertise of dental professionals can influence the prices of dental treatments. Dentists may need to charge higher fees to cover their education costs and maintain their skills.
  5. Lack of public coverage: Dental care in Iceland is not covered by the country’s national health insurance system, which means individuals are responsible for paying for their dental treatments out of pocket or through private dental insurance. Without public coverage, dental clinics do not have a predetermined fee structure, allowing them more flexibility in setting prices.
